加入收藏 | 设为首页 | 会员中心 | 我要投稿 李大同 (https://www.lidatong.com.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 综合聚焦 > 服务器 > 安全 > 正文

远程登录和复制文件

发布时间:2020-12-15 07:18:21 所属栏目:安全 来源:网络整理
导读:命令: ssh 对应英文: secure shell 使用: ssh [-P] 用户名@ip 优点: 加密和压缩,即安全和提高传输速度 注意: 除了windows系统外的系统默认有ssh客户端,直接使用命令便可; windows系统需要使用其他工具来远程连接,例如Xshell,Putty 命令: scp 对应

命令:

  ssh

对应英文:

  secure shell

使用:

  ssh [-P] 用户名@ip

优点:

  加密和压缩,即安全和提高传输速度

注意:

  除了windows系统外的系统默认有ssh客户端,直接使用命令便可;

  windows系统需要使用其他工具来远程连接,例如Xshell,Putty


命令:

  scp

对应英文:

  secure?copy

作用:

  远程复制文件

选项:

  -r:若给出的源文件是目录文件,则scp将递归复制该目录下的所有子目录和文件,目标文件必须为一个目录名

  -P:若远程SSH服务器的端口不是22,需要使用大写字母 -P?选项指定端口(默认端口22则不需要添加该选项)

使用:

  scp [-P]?源文件?目标文件

例子:

  #?把本地当前目录下的01.py文件复制到远程家目录下的Desktop/01.py

  #?注意:?冒号:后面的路径如果不是绝对路径,则以用户的家目录作为参照路径

  scp -P port 01.py user@remote:Desktop/01.py

  

  #?把远程家目录下的Desktop/01.py文件复制到本地当前目录下的01.py

  scp -P?port?user@remote:Desktop/01.py 01.py

注意:

  scp命令只能在linux和unix系统下使用;

  windows系统可以安装Putty,使用pscp命令;或者安装FileZilla使用FTP进行文件传输,需要注意的是FTP服务的端口是21

  


域名和端口号:

  域名是IP地址的别名,例如 www.baidu.com

  可以通过端口号找到计算机上运行的应用程序

常见的服务端口号:

  SSH服务器:22

  Web服务器:80

  HTTPS:443

  FTP服务器:21

(编辑:李大同)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章
      热点阅读